Public bug reported: The packet postgresql-plperl (and probably other addon packages for postgresql) blocks do-release-upgrade from 16.04LTS to 18.04LTS.

This requiresthen requires a complete dump-and-restore cycle: 1) Stop user applications 2) do a full database export 3) stop postgresql 4) uninstall postgresql and all subpackages 5) delete remaining tablespace directories 6) do-release-upgrade 7) reinstall postgresql and the required subpackages 8) restore database from backup 9) start user applications This requires a much longer downtime than just using pg_upgradecluster, because the database is offline during the whole do-release-upgrade cycle.
